Prohibiting harassment through electronic communication.


    AN ACT Relating to harassment through electronic communication; and amending RCW 9.61.230.

 

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WASHINGTON:

 

    Sec. 1.  RCW 9.61.230 and 1992 c 186 s 6 are each amended to read as follows:

    Every person who, with intent to harass, intimidate, torment or embarrass any other person, shall make a telephone call or send an electronic communication to such other person:

    (1) Using any lewd, lascivious, profane, indecent, or obscene words or language, or suggesting the commission of any lewd or lascivious act; or

    (2) Anonymously or repeatedly or at an extremely inconvenient hour, whether or not conversation ensues; or

    (3) Threatening to inflict injury on the person or property of the person called or any member of his or her family or household;

shall be guilty of a gross misdemeanor, except that the person is guilty of a class C felony if either of the following applies:

    (a) That person has previously been convicted of any crime of harassment, as defined in RCW 9A.46.060, with the same victim or member of the victim's family or household or any person specifically named in a no-contact or no-harassment order in this or any other state; or

    (b) That person harasses another person under subsection (3) of this section by threatening to kill the person threatened or any other person.
